Man who set other man on fire arrested

Juan Jesus Robles charged with attempted capital murder

Juan Jesus Robles, 37, was charged with attempted capital murder. Police said that he poured gasoline on a man and then set him on fire.

SAN ANTONIO – An arrest has been made in the gruesome attack on a man that happened more than two weeks ago.

Juan Jesus Robles, 37, is charged with attempted capital murder.

Police said he doused a man with gasoline and then set him on fire.

The attack happened on Jan. 7 on the Guadalupe Street bridge.

A police officer spotted the man seconds later and was able to put out the flames.

The victim survived and told police three men attacked him.

Police said Robles robbed the victim before setting him ablaze.

Robles was already in jail on an unrelated offense.
